Basic Concepts of Plain Hoses
Plain hoses are flexible tubes used in fluid transfer systems to convey liquids or gases from one point to another. They are integral in various applications, including automotive, industrial, and hydraulic systems. Plain hoses operate by providing a flexible conduit that can withstand pressure, temperature variations, and movement without compromising the integrity of the fluid transfer. Their design allows for easy installation and replacement, making them a practical choice for many applications 1.

Troubleshooting Common Issues
Common issues associated with plain hoses include leaks, abrasions, and kinks. To address these problems, it is important to regularly inspect the hose for signs of wear or damage. Leaks may indicate a faulty connection or hose degradation, requiring re-securing or replacement. Abrasions can be mitigated by ensuring the hose is routed away from sharp edges or moving parts. Kinks should be straightened to restore proper fluid flow, and the routing of the hose may need to be adjusted to prevent recurrence.

Cummins Engine Compatibility with Part 5396203
This part is designed to fit seamlessly within a variety of Cummins engine models. This part is integral to the engine’s operation, ensuring proper fluid flow and system integrity. Here is a detailed look at its compatibility across different engine types:
ISB6.7 Series
- ISB6.7 CM2250
- ISB6.7 CM2350 B101
- ISB6.7 G CM2180 B118
This part is specifically engineered to fit within the ISB6.7 series engines. These engines are known for their robust performance and reliability, making them a popular choice in various applications. The hose ensures that the fluid pathways remain unobstructed, contributing to the engine’s overall efficiency and longevity.
QSB6.7 Series
- QSB6.7 CM2250
- QSB6.7 CM2350 B105
Similarly, this part is compatible with the QSB6.7 series engines. These engines are designed for versatility and are often used in a range of industries, from agriculture to construction. The hose’s design ensures that it can handle the specific demands of these engines, maintaining the necessary fluid flow and pressure.
